One of the most well - known international standards for motors is the International Electrotechnical Commission (IEC) standards. The IEC has a set of standards that cover various aspects of electrical equipment, including motors. For our 5.5KW Electromagnetic Brake Induction Motor, the IEC 60034 series is particularly relevant. This series includes standards for rotating electrical machines, such as requirements for performance, temperature rise, and insulation.
Compliance with IEC 60034 standards means that the motor has been tested for efficiency, power factor, and other performance parameters. For example, the efficiency of the motor is an important factor as it directly affects energy consumption. A motor that meets IEC 60034 standards will generally be more energy - efficient, which can save you money in the long run.
Another important standard is the NEMA (National Electrical Manufacturers Association) standard, which is widely used in North America. NEMA standards define the physical and electrical characteristics of motors, including frame sizes, mounting dimensions, and performance ratings. If you're planning to use the 5.5KW Electromagnetic Brake Induction Motor in a North American market or in a system that follows NEMA - compliant equipment, it's crucial that the motor meets these standards.
In addition to these international and regional standards, there are also safety - related standards. The IEC 61140 standard, for instance, deals with electrical safety requirements for equipment. This standard ensures that the motor is designed to prevent electrical shock, overheating, and other safety hazards. Motors that comply with IEC 61140 have features like proper insulation, grounding, and protection against short - circuits.
Now, let's talk about certifications. One of the most common certifications for electrical equipment is the CE certification. The CE mark indicates that the motor complies with all relevant European Union (EU) health, safety, and environmental protection directives. If you're planning to sell or use the 5.5KW Electromagnetic Brake Induction Motor in the EU market, having a CE - certified motor is a must.
The UL (Underwriters Laboratories) certification is also very important, especially for the North American market. UL tests and certifies products to ensure they meet strict safety standards. A UL - certified 5.5KW Electromagnetic Brake Induction Motor has been thoroughly tested for fire, electrical shock, and mechanical hazards.
